Excision Limits of Oral Cavity Tumor by NARROW BAND IMAGING (NBI): Feasibility Trial


Inclusion Criteria:



- Primitive epidermoid cancer of the oral cavity, proved by histology, not treated
previously, patient having a surgery

- No previous surgery for this cancer

- Age > 18 years

- Patient affiliated to health insurance

- Consent signed by the patient

Exclusion Criteria:

- Metastatic or recurrent disease

- Health care impossibilities for geographic, social, psychic reasons

Type of Study:

Interventional

Study Design:

Intervention Model: Single Group Assignment, Masking: Open Label, Primary Purpose: Diagnostic

Outcome Measure:

Reliability for detection of subclinical lesions

Outcome Description:

Concordance between the histological data and the lesions detected by the NBI technique

Outcome Time Frame:

baseline

Safety Issue:

No
